E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
thinkphp5开发规范
thinkphp5
.0实现导出excel带图片
phpexcel插件:https://pan.baidu.com/s/1rNTs9BWMeA5mzcUepy9RDg提取码:putk效果图:将phpexcel插件存放到/extend目录中import('PHPExcel/PHPExcel',EXTEND_PATH);classMessageControllersextendsBaseAdmin{//导出publicfunctionexportEx
if时光重来
·
2023-07-21 04:29
php
php
phpexcel
phpexcel导出图片
前端
开发规范
说明
1.注释,每个事件或者方法上面都要有注释2.每个接口请求都是做成功和失败的判断处理3.后台的提示统一为diy(红色)提示,前端的提示统一为warning(黄色)提示4.所有表格增加自适应高度,loading效果5.保存,删除,提交等直接访问后台接口的按钮必须加防重复提交功能即加loading效果6.全屏的表格的分页必须改为支持选择每页条数的分页器即(@components/page1组件)7.变量
鄢宁
·
2023-07-21 01:12
Thinkphp5
+Workerman
今天整理一个Workerman的小例子按照
Thinkphp5
的手册来配置一下网址如下:https://www.kancloud.cn/manual/
thinkphp5
/235128在onWorkerStart
RocaLee
·
2023-07-20 21:22
thinkphp5
切换多语言
请求时候:1、header中增加:Accept-Language语言2、在请求地址中增加lang=语言参数
若尘拂风
·
2023-07-20 20:30
php
Git Commitizen 简单集成须知
cz-cli此工具可为开发者提供可选择的commit提交,提交的type分为以下几种:-feat:新feature,新增一个新的功能点-fix:bugfix,修复某个已知bug-docs:文档变更(比如项目中的
开发规范
文档
overla5
·
2023-07-20 15:34
上市公司前端
开发规范
参考
上市公司前端
开发规范
参考命名规则通用约定文件与目录命名HTML命名CSS命名JS命名代码格式通用约定HTML格式CSS格式JS格式注释组件组件大小单文件组件容器组件组件使用说明Prop指令缩写组件通讯组件的挂载和销毁按需加载第三方组件库的规定脚手架使用规范移动端脚手架
秋叶原的琴音
·
2023-07-20 13:35
前端
前端
代码规范
【开源分享】在线客服系统源代码-thinphp网站在线客服系统源码(附源码完整搭建教程)...
基于
ThinkPHP5
+workerman,整体架构比较老,PHP客服端以及界面等需要在php-fpm下运行,即时通讯websocket服务端需要命令行执行。
小红帽2.0
·
2023-07-19 11:27
开源
Android
开发规范
Android
开发规范
工欲善其事,必先利其器。为了有利于项目维护、增强代码可读性、提升CodeReview效率以及规范团队安卓开发,特此整理了一篇Android基本
开发规范
,期望能帮助团队成长。
ydYa
·
2023-07-17 20:05
Android
android
本地资源检测 自定义规则 零基础上手指南
可以全面自动检测项目静态工程内各项资源、代码和设置,能够帮助项目组制定合理的资源与代码标准,及时发现潜在的性能问题和异常错误,建立有效的
开发规范
。
UWA
·
2023-07-17 18:49
充电一刻
UWA优化日
前端
数据库
性能优化
UWA
记一次FastAdmin后台Getshell
文章目录一、FastAdmin介绍二、测试过程三、总结一、FastAdmin介绍FastAdmin是基于
ThinkPHP5
和Bootstrap的极速后台开发框架。
culprits
·
2023-07-17 18:53
笔记
安全
web安全
路径替换
thinkphp5
.1月
thinkPHP5
.0不同没有默认设置任何模板替换变量,如果需要使用模板替换,需要在template.php配置文件中添加如下:'tpl_replace_string'=>['_
小蝎子tt
·
2023-07-17 14:01
thinkphp5
连接多数据库
1.打开/application/database.php2.在return[]中最后一行添加数据库配置代码"db_text"=>[//数据库类型'type'=>Env::get('database.type','mysql'),//服务器地址'hostname'=>Env::get('database.hostname','127.0.0.7'),//数据库名'database'=>Env::g
微齐天大圣.
·
2023-07-17 10:54
thinkphp5
数据库
tp5连接多数据库
thinkphp漏洞总结
.xSQL注入前言thinkphp是一个国内轻量级的开发框架,采用php+apache,在更新迭代中,thinkphp也经常爆出各种漏洞,thinkphp一般有thinkphp2、thinkphp3、
thinkphp5
小东西的东西
·
2023-07-17 01:15
面试
学习路线
阿里巴巴
安全
web安全
php
运维
jvm
Redis中的bigKey问题
对于bigkey的判定标准,《阿里云redis
开发规范
》中规定了:对于String类型value,value占用空间大于10kb,对于list,hash,set,zset类型若元素个数超过5000,就算
L-KKKKK
·
2023-07-16 19:16
redis
数据库
缓存
Swift 日常
开发规范
文章目录前言一、命名规约二、定义、修饰规约三、格式规约四、简略规约五、注释规约六、编译效率规约工具相关规范前言《Swift
开发规范
》发布之后得到了很多Swifter的关注,很多读者提议最好为每条规约添加一些代码示例
烟花下的孤独
·
2023-07-16 11:07
swift
swift
开发语言
ios
BI-SQL丨XML
这个就要从SQLServer的应用开始说起了,众所周知,SQL作为计算机的通用语言之一,在各个领域都存在广泛的应用,也有着各式各样的
开发规范
要求,但是并不是所有的场景下,开发者都会遵循相关的规范。
PowerBI丨白茶
·
2023-07-16 08:21
PowerBI丨SQL
sql
xml
数据库
Android
开发规范
(基础版)
背景项目的代码时间时间很长,经过太多人手,代码的规范性堪忧,目前存在较多的比较自由的「代码规范」,这非常不利于项目的维护,代码可读性也不够高。分析现有项目的代码的情况,输出的『定制化规范』文档,用于提高代码的可读性和可维护性。收益对于个人:帮助团队写「正确」的代码,提升编程能力。团队内部:统一项目的编码风格,降低维护『非自己模块』的成本对外部门:交付更加稳定的产品,并降低后期的维护难度开发工具配置
艾阳Blog
·
2023-07-16 01:47
android
【漏洞预警】
ThinkPHP5
远程代码执行漏洞
此次爆出漏洞的
ThinkPHP5
.x版本是官方于2015年发布的新一代框架,其中5.1.0RC版本于今年的5月2日发布,但在短短几个月
odaycaogen
·
2023-07-15 22:28
Unity
开发规范
代码控制频繁调用GC控制高频率的内存分配。控制大块的内存申请,可能会造成内存的碎片化,如果需要申请,尽可能在刚启动时申请。控制容易导致GCalloc的函数调用[Mono]控制字符串拼接/ToString/ToArray[Mono]Boxing(拆装箱操作)/委托/匿名函数[Mono]Tag/Name/Mesh.Vertices[Lua]Vector等非基础类型的参数传递脚本注意事项:避免Updat
老久酒
·
2023-07-15 14:04
unity
规范
C#
阿里TL
中,阿里巴巴高级技术专家云狄从
开发规范
、开发流程、技术规划与管理三个角度,分享对技术TL的理解与思考。
edison0428
·
2023-07-15 08:36
墙裂推荐,2023年最强、最实用的IDEA插件推荐合集
插件目录AlibabaJavaCodingGuidelines(阿里巴巴java
开发规范
)AlibabaCloudAICodingAssistant(阿里云AI代码助理)CodeGlance3(代码地图
@码小白
·
2023-07-15 06:52
Java学习
日常分享
intellij-idea
java
大数据
后端
Java
开发规范
文章目录后端1、新增2、更新3、删除4、查询5、文件业务数据库表设计后端1、新增主键ID填充类型,创建时间、更新时间、创建用户,更新用户。建议每个对象都应该保证有这些数据。参数校验问题。新增接口的参数对象,应该按每个字段的约束,进行字段校验。前后端都得校验,按开发进度进行调整。要求后端必须校验,参考实体注解参数校验。请求类型。使用POST请求类型。重复点击问题。建议全局问题,前后端都可做新增时重复
与梦想同在
·
2023-07-15 00:07
JAVA
java
API|99%后端程序员都知道的接口
开发规范
1.签名对外提供的接口要做签名认证,认证不通过的请求不允许访问接口、提供服务。2.加密敏感数据在网络传输过程中应该加密3.Ip白名单限制请求的IP,增加IP白名单,一般在网关层处理。4.限流尤其是对外提供的接口,无法保障调用的频率,应该做限流处理,保障接口服务正常提供服务。5.参数校验即使前端做了非空,规范性校验,服务端参数校验仍然是非常必要的。6.统一返回值一个服务一套同意的数据返回结果和传参规
懂电商API接口的Jennifer
·
2023-07-14 16:17
电商API知识分享
数据挖掘
网络爬虫
大数据
网络
thinkphp5
.0.24反序列化漏洞分析
thinkphp5
.0.24反序列化漏洞分析文章目录
thinkphp5
.0.24反序列化漏洞分析具体分析反序列化起点toArraygetRelationData分析$modelRelation生成进入_
bp粉
·
2023-07-14 13:59
面试
学习路线
阿里巴巴
安全
php
web安全
数据库
开发语言
chapter10:SpringBoot与缓存
尚硅谷SpringBoot整合教程1.JSR107缓存
开发规范
,JavaCaching定义了5个核心接口,分别是CachingProvider,CacheManager,Cache,Entry和Expiry
crysw
·
2023-07-14 11:27
SpringBoot
spring
boot
缓存
java
技术分享 | TiDB 对大事务的简单拆分
长期以来,在MySQL的
开发规范
ActionTech
·
2023-07-14 10:11
技术分享
TiDB
大事务拆分
抖音seo源码开发部署技术分享(一)
开发要求:遵守抖音平台的
开发规范
和技术要求,如开发文档、SDK等。技术要求:掌握H
云罗张晓_zz70933
·
2023-07-14 03:59
抖音seo优化
抖音seo源码
抖音矩阵系统
矩阵
python
开源
开源软件
sass
记录一次使用
thinkphp5
分页器获取数据
//输出当前页$nowPage=$data->currentPage();//输出总条数$total=$data->total();//输出当前页条数$listRows=$data->listRows();db('tablename')->where("id>0")->paginate(10,true,['page'=>4]);//每页显示10条记录,且打开第4页(如果第4页存在)为了方便读取数据
自己给自己创造机会
·
2023-07-14 01:22
服务器
linux
redis
9、架构:CLI 设计
在之前有一篇企业级CLI开发实战介绍过如何开发一款适用团队的CLI工具,基于团队规范可以将项目脚手架与CLI强制绑定在一起,约束开发者使用的开发语言以及
开发规范
,但是对于一款通用性的低代码产品,基于业务类型的物料开发经常会存
Jeffrey Dean
·
2023-07-13 18:47
从
0
打造通用型低代码产品
李智慧 - 架构师训练营总览
常见架构师岗位职责:负责产品及项目的整体架构设计,开发系统核心模块规划业务架构的合理演进,能够制定合理的开发工作计划并实施制定相关技术
开发规范
,对通用技术进行整理,提高技术复用优化现有架构,提出合理可行的重构方案对新技术保持非常高的敏感度
eddieHoo
·
2023-07-13 17:02
李智慧
架构
接口设计与
开发规范
设计JAVA开发的接口规范,需要满足以下要求:controller类指定@Api注解指定@Api的value属性、指定@Api的tags属性controller类接口对应方法指定@ApiOperation注解指定@ApiOperation的value属性接口命名请以listing,delete,add等英文字母开头,目前定义的英文开头参考如下:新增接口:addXxx分页接口:pagingXxx列表
勤_
·
2023-07-12 13:43
学习路线总结
1.网站1)开发:IDEA、eclipse、jdk、tomcat2)阿里
开发规范
:http://baijiahao.baidu.com/s?
leslieYoung
·
2023-06-24 01:10
【springboot整合】Spring缓存抽象
JSR-107简介为了统一缓存
开发规范
,以及提升缓存开发的扩展性,J2EE发布了JSR-107缓存
开发规范
。
小肆2019
·
2023-06-23 09:27
spring
缓存
spring
boot
thinkphp5
使用phpword生成固定模板
所需工具composer2:官网下载下来安装即可2.所需依赖在
thinkphp5
的项目根目录下运行安装命令:composerrequirephpoffice/phpword然后再package.json
风/xin云
·
2023-06-23 01:02
php
ThinkPHP5
.1 Excel表格导入
1.使用composer安装phpexcel类库打开项目根目录的composer.json文件将以下写入到require下面"phpoffice/phpexcel":"^1.8"image.png2.在项目根目录执行composerrequirephpoffice/phpexcel安装成功后,会注意到项目的vendor目录下,多出了一个phpoffice文件夹3.读取excel文件转换成数组pub
烂孩子
·
2023-06-22 21:51
Java
开发规范
学习--日期和时间
摘录部分官网的说明《Java开发手册》始于阿里内部规约,在全球Java开发者共同努力下,已成为业界普遍遵循的
开发规范
。
·
2023-06-21 23:50
推荐超好用的 6 款 Laravel Admin 管理模版
如果您正在为您的企业调研开发Admin管理后台的最佳方案,那么基于PHP的Laravel框架会是一个不错的选择,它灵活且易用,还提供了一系列
开发规范
和组件加速我们的开发。
·
2023-06-21 18:49
谷粒商城-基础篇-总结
分布式基础概念(1)微服务(2)Nacos注册中心(3)Nacos配置中心(4)远程调用-feign(5)网关-gateway2、基础开发(1)SpringCloud(2)阿里云对象存储(OSS)3、环境4、
开发规范
橘子保安
·
2023-06-21 15:19
spring
cloud
微服务
java
谷粒商城
基础篇总结
flink 实时数仓构建与开发[记录一些坑]
记-flink实时数仓搭建、开发、维护笔记业务场景描述数仓架构数仓分层odsdimdwddws数仓建模注意项数仓建模
开发规范
命名规范问题与原因分析1、debezium采集pg表,数据类型问题2、业务库出现大批量刷表数据
cg6
·
2023-06-20 08:24
flink
大数据
flink
kafka
java
数仓架构、模型设计与优化、
开发规范
数仓模型设计与
开发规范
数仓架构数据存储设计
开发规范
表名定义规范字段命名(字段类型)规范指标一致性规范维度一致性规范离线数仓模型构建的简单见解1、业务数据与架构变化情况说明2、数据分层说明2.1ods层模型说明
cg6
·
2023-06-20 08:23
数仓技术知识
sql
golang代码规范之业务
开发规范
项目采用领域驱动模型的充血模型开发,业务实现都在internal目录下,业务分层为server、service、biz、data、config。server层为服务注册层,注册系统的http、grpc服务等;service层为接口层,处理外部请求,调用内部实现,然后返回数据。biz层为业务逻辑层,根据service层传入的输入,根据业务目的,调用data层获取数据进行业务处理。data层用于和数据
谢小鱼
·
2023-06-20 07:45
go
代码规范
golang
DDD
开发规范
目录和文件目录使用小写+下划线;类的文件名均以命名空间定义,并且命名空间的路径和类库文件所在路径一致;类文件采用驼峰法命名(首字母大写),其它文件采用小写+下划线命名;类名和类文件名保持一致,统一采用驼峰法命名(首字母大写);函数和类、属性命名类的命名采用驼峰法(首字母大写),例如User、UserType,默认不需要添加后缀,例如UserController应该直接命名为User;函数的命名使用
GaoYuan117
·
2023-06-20 03:31
Redis总结
stringListhashsetzsetSpringBoot整合Redis数据持久化RDBAOP如何选用持久化机制:集群配置主从复制哨兵模式Cluster模式企业级解决方案redis脑裂缓存预热缓存穿透缓存击穿缓存雪崩redis
开发规范
数据一致性什么是
c_mmmmmmm
·
2023-06-20 00:27
redis
数据库
缓存
前端开发的一些规范
转载整理一些前端
开发规范
文档这份文档已经写了差不多一年了,最近也更新过了,作为一个有组织和纪律的团队,规范是必须的,毕竟每个coder都有自己的一套风格和规范,为了以后团队的和谐发展,结合前端业界的开发经验
凉介Seven
·
2023-06-19 15:40
用那种方式安装 ThinkPHP 5.0?
ThinkPHP5
.0版本是一个颠覆和重构版本,采用全新的架构思想,引入了更多的PHP新特性,优化了核心,减少了依赖,实现了真正的惰性加载,支持composer,并针对API开发做了大量的优化。
L小臣
·
2023-06-18 16:25
php框架
php
开发语言
thinkphp
DTCloud模块
开发规范
DTCloud模块
开发规范
1.应用模块目录项目名称统一的前缀dt_统一为英语字母小写不用驼峰表示法,如果有多个单词,建议以"_"分隔,比如dictionary_management这两个单词之间为_下划线
·
2023-06-18 12:59
后端python
ThinkPHP5
和ThinkPHP6的区别
本文作者:陈进坚个人博客:https://jian1098.github.ioCSDN博客:https://blog.csdn.net/c_jian:https://www.jianshu.com/u/8ba9ac5706b6联系方式:
[email protected]
.安装方式thinkphp6只能通过composer安装composerconfig-grepo.packagistcomposer
不能吃的坚果j
·
2023-06-18 11:19
Ginkgo:一款 BDD 的 Go 语言框架
单元测试之上是
开发规范
。在敏捷软件开发中,有
机器铃砍菜刀
·
2023-06-18 02:34
单元测试
软件测试
编程语言
go
junit
phpword模版替换插入html实现以及表格合并列的部分实现
标签phpword模版替换插入html实现以及表格合并列的部分实现新建自定义类,文件名TemplateProcessor.php,以扩展phpword的TemplateProcessor类;实际项目为
thinkphp5
.1
lazy_ant
·
2023-06-17 08:50
html
php
[
thinkPHP5
项目实战_09]后台添加栏目及验证
1.后台的模板分离和URL生成上一篇介绍了前台页面的模板分离和URL生成,构建博客系统还需要后台管理系统,通过类似的方法构建后台的模板其中cate.php为文章管理控制器,Cate类下面的add函数用于添加文章fetch();}publicfunctionadd(){return$this->fetch();}}index.php为后台首页控制器:fetch();}}完成后台模板引入后,后台首页地
骑着代马去流浪
·
2023-06-16 23:59
ThinkPHP5博客系统
tp5验证
tp5表单提交
tp5插入数据库
上一页
12
13
14
15
16
17
18
19
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他